Transcription of Target Genes

Under normoxic conditions HIFα is hydroxylated by HIFα -specific prolylhydroxylases (PHD1-3), which are oxygen sensing. Hydroxylation triggerspoly-ubiquitylation of HIFα and targets it for proteasomal degradation by anE3 ubiquitin ligase, the von Hippel-Lindau protein (pVHL) complex. Hypoxiaand TCA cycle intermediates inhibit hydroxylation and stabilize the protein.HIFα subunits are also substrates for an asparaginyl hydroxylasefactor-inhibiting HIF1α (FIH1). This enzyme is also oxygen sensing andhydroxylation by FIH1 disrupts a critical interaction between HIFα subunitsand co-activators such as p300/CBP, impairing HIF transcriptional activity.

Regulation of HIFα stability can also be mediated by an oxygen-independentpathway. In the cytoplasm, HIFα is bound to heat-shock protein 90 (Hsp90)and this association leads to enhanced stability of the subunit. However,upon displacement of Hsp90 by Hsp90 inhibitors, receptor of activatedprotein C kinase (RACK1) is able to bind and acts to recruit ubiquitin ligasemachinery and potentiate the degradation of the α-subunit.
